Easy Greek Chips Omelette Avga Omeleta Me Patates

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:25 mins
Servings: 2

Ingredients

  • 2 pieces Large potatoes
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 4 pieces Large eggs
  • 2 tablespoons Milk
  • 50 grams Feta cheese (optional)
  • 0.5 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ons Ground black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h parsley (optional, chopped)

Directions

Step 1

Peel the potatoes and slice them into thin rounds, about 1/8-inch thick. Pat them dry with a clean kitchen towel to remove excess moisture.

Step 2

In a large nonstick skillet, heat 3 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Add the potato slices and spread them out evenly in a single layer. Sprinkle with a pinch of salt.

Step 3

Cook the potatoes for 7-8 minutes, flipping them occasionally, until they are golden and crispy on both sides. Remove the skillet from the heat and use a slotted spoon to transfer the potatoes to a plate lined with paper towels to drain excess oil.

Step 4

In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, salt, and pepper until fully combined and slightly frothy. If using feta cheese, crumble it into the egg mixture and mix gently.

Step 5

Wipe the skillet clean with a paper towel, then return it to medium heat with 1 more tablespoon of olive oil if needed to prevent sticking.

Step 6

Spread the cooked potatoes evenly in the skillet, then pour the egg mixture over them, ensuring the eggs fully coat the potatoes.

Step 7

Lower the heat to medium-low and cook the omelette for about 5-7 minutes, or until the edges are set and the center is slightly jiggly.

Step 8

Carefully slide the omelette onto a large plate. Place the skillet upside-down over the omelette, then flip the plate and skillet together to cook the other side. Cook for another 2-3 minutes until fully set.

Step 9

Slide the omelette onto a serving plate, garnish with fresh parsley if desired, and serve warm.
